Redbubble vs Etsy: A Head-to-Head Comparability

Creating a web based retailer? Your selection between Redbubble and Etsy is determined by the way you wish to showcase your work. 

Signing Up

You’ll must create an account to start promoting on both platform. With Redbubble, your identify, e mail deal with, bodily deal with, and cost particulars are all required. After coming into this info, you possibly can select a retailer identify and begin importing designs instantly. 

The sign-up course of with Etsy is barely extra concerned; along with all the main points talked about above, you will need to create your first itemizing throughout the sign-up course of.

Itemizing Objects for Sale

As soon as it comes time to add your work on the market, the distinctions between Redbubble and Etsy turn out to be obvious.

On Redbubble, customers can solely add paintings in PNG or JPEG format after which merely determine what merchandise they want the design utilized to. As well as, they’ll add titles and descriptions in addition to tags to categorize their designs additional. 

In distinction, when itemizing gadgets on the market on Etsy, customers must enter way more info, together with titles and lengthy descriptions, tags, product classes, pricing info, and delivery/return insurance policies. This course of takes considerably extra time than that Redbubble.

Product Sorts and the Promoting Course of

It could all come all the way down to the kind of product you wish to promote when choosing between the 2 e-commerce platforms. Redbubble is fashionable amongst creatives who’re pushed for time as a result of it provides a ‘hands-off’ method.

You merely add your paintings, and so they print and ship the on-demand merchandise to clients. The choice contains t-shirts, attire, hoodies, caps, laptop computer/pill sleeves, wall artwork prints, and way more. 

Etsy enables you to select from handmade, classic, or craft provide gadgets at the least 20 years outdated. Right here you will need to supply or make the merchandise your self, providing clients extra high quality management and a private contact. Common classes embody craft provides, handmade gadgets, jewellery, and residential decor.

Transaction Charges: Redbubble vs Etsy

Transaction charges and revenue margins can range considerably between totally different on-line platforms. At Redbubble, sellers management the markup of their merchandise, with most aiming for 15-20% above the bottom worth. For instance, promoting a big framed artwork print to the U.S. may lead to a revenue of $25, though this may very well be too excessive to draw patrons. 

Conversely, sellers on Etsy retain a a lot bigger slice of the sale worth. With each buy, Etsy takes a 6.5% transaction charge, plus 3% for cost processing and a $0.25 flat price.

Itemizing new merchandise or restocking present listings incurs a further $0.20. Contemplating all charges, a sale of a U.S. merchandise for $100, together with delivery, ought to consequence within the artist receiving $90.05, or 90% of the client’s cost. Even promoting merchandise for as little as $10, sellers can count on to maintain round 86%.

Cost 

Financing your enterprise on both Redbubble or Etsy may be made straightforward by the varied cost choices obtainable. Each platforms provide totally different options to suit your wants, however understanding these requires extra analysis. 

Redbubble’s cost system is kind of easy: earnings are paid out robotically each single month as soon as an account reaches $20. A PayPal account or direct deposit are the 2 commonest cost choices, with Redbubble issuing funds in your foreign money. Nonetheless, for those who select the latter, bear in mind that solely Australian, U.S., and U.Ok. financial institution accounts are supported. 

In the meantime, Etsy has not too long ago arrange a novel service known as Etsy Funds. In addition to providing clients extra methods to pay than the earlier PayPal-only system, this service permits cash to be despatched to a vendor’s account by way of direct deposit.

Sellers can select each day, weekly, biweekly, or month-to-month transfers from Etsy Funds to their accounts, though they have to meet the minimal threshold worth for the switch to happen of their native foreign money.
